titleOfInvention | Process and developer composition for the development of exposed negative-working diazonium salt layers |
abstract | The invention relates to a developer mixture for developing exposed light-sensitive reproduction layers which contain a diazonium salt polycondensation product. The mixture is based on water, a salt of an alkanoic acid and a surfactant and contains 0.5 to 15% by weight, in particular 1 to 10% by weight, of at least one salt of an alkanoic acid with 8 to 13 carbon atoms and 0.5 to 20% by weight, in particular 1 to 12% by weight, of at least one low-foaming, nonionic surfactant. These surfactants preferably include optionally modified block polymers of ethylene and propylene oxide.n n n The invention further relates to a method for developing negative working reproduction layers of the above composition with the developer mixture according to the invention. |
